Kwara Governor Receives Africa's First Badminton Medalist, Mariam Eniola Bolaji
News report from The Informant247 indicate that Kwara State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q on Monday, welcomed Mariam Eniola Bolaji, Kwara-born badminton star and Africa's first badminton medalist at the Olympic or Paralympics at Government House, Ilorin.
Eniola, who was recently ranked World Number Two in the game, was received by His Excellency, Governor AbdulRazaq with an undiluted joy.
Unable to contain his joy, the Governor said, “Your triumph serves as an inspiration to millions of young athletes across the nation, and we are proud to have you represent our state and country.”
The 18-year-old badminton star is one of the many Kwara-born athletes who have benefited from Governor AbdulRazaq's generosity in sports.
Recently, he sponsored two underage scrabble players to represent the country at the 2024 World Youths Scrabble Championship Sri Lanka.
Commenting on her recent historic feats at the game both as World Number Two and Africa's first badminton medalist at the Olympic or Paralympics, Governor AbdulRazaq described Eniola as a great ambassador of the State.
“Eniola has been a great ambassador of our state, and we are so proud to identify with her feats,” he said.
The Governor also reiterated his administration's commitment to continue to offer Eniola Mariam all necessary support as she continues to make the State and Nigeria proud.
“Our government will continue to support the para-badminton talent every step of the way. Once again, congratulations, Eniola!” the Governor said.
The newly constructed world-class sporting facilities by the Governor AbdulRazaq-led administration have received excellent remarks from sports lovers and veterans including former President, Chief Olusegun Obasanjo.
Receiving the badminton star, the Governor promised to build more sports facilities in the State.
Eniola was accompanied to the meeting by the Executive Chairman of the Kwara State Sports Commission, Mallam Bolakale Mogaji, who expressed his undiluted gratitude to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q for his unwavering support for Kwara athletes and sports development in the State.
The emotional and grateful Mariam Eniola Bolaji also extended her gratitude to Governor AbdulRazaq for supporting her career over the years.
She stressed how the Governor's exemplary leadership in sports and other sectors have contributed to her success. “I am grateful for your words of encouragement and the efforts you've put into creating opportunities for athletes like myself,” the badminton star said.
